Lindsay Gordon, Scottish journalist and amateur sleuth, was the first creation of international bestseller Val McDermid. Report for Murder introduced the United Kingdom’s first lesbian detective, and the series has been perennially popular ever since. British upper-crust sleuth The Honorable Daisy Dalrymple investigates a rash of poison pen letters sent to people in her brother-in-law's village. The mystery escalates when Daisy stumbles on a murder.
